Vite构建过程中,插件可以利用哪些生命周期钩子

2 min read

Vite构建过程中,插件可以利用以下生命周期钩子:

  1. config:在解析配置文件时调用,可以修改、添加配置项。
  2. serverStart:在启动开发服务器之前调用,可以进行一些自定义的操作。
  3. configureServer:在配置开发服务器之前调用,可以对服务器进行配置。
  4. transform:在文件转换期间调用,可以对文件进行转换、处理等操作。
  5. handleHotUpdate:在热更新时调用,可以处理热更新相关的操作。
  6. closeBundle:在打包完成后调用,可以进行最后的操作,比如生成分析报告等。